50 Dollars Battle of Midway
1992 yearSilver | 31.1 g | 38 mm |
Issuer | Marshall Islands |
---|---|
Period | Republic (1979-date) |
Type | Non-circulating coin |
Year | 1992 |
Value | 50 Dollars (50 USD) |
Currency | Dollar (1986-date) |
Composition | Silver |
Weight | 31.1 g |
Diameter | 38 mm |
Shape | Round |
Technique | Milled |
Updated | 2024-10-06 |
Numista | N#174810 |

Reverse
Bombers diving toward a naval ship, denomination below, dates bottom
Lettering:
TO · THE · HEROES · OF BATTLE · OF · MIDWAY
FIFTY DOLLARS
1942 1992
Comment
Obverse: State seal and legend. Reverse: TO THE HEROES OF BATTLE OF MIDWAY 1942-1992Interesting fact
